- The distance between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ands, French Southern Lands and Mzuzu, Malawi is approximately 5,367 km or 3,335 mi.
- To reach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ands in this distance one would set out from Mzuzu bearing 148.9°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ands bearing 129.1° or SE .
-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Mzuzu has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
-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ands is in or near the boreal rain forest biome whereas Mzuzu is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 13.2 °C (23.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.9 °C (3.4°F) less in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 580.7 mm (22.9 in) less which is equivalent to 580.7 l/m² (14.25 US gal/ft²) or 5,807,000 l/ha (620,807 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.4° lower in Port-Aux-Francais, kerguelen islands than in Mzuzu.
